Sarah Brasher 1793–1870 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 3 March 1793
Birth Location: Greenville County, South Carolina, United States of America
Death Date: Aft 1870
Death Location: Kentucky, USA
Father: Thomas Brasher
Mother: Catherine Armstrong
Spouse(s): Jeremiah Hamby, James Hamby
Children(s): Campaspa Hamby, Prueesia Hamby, Maryann Hamby, Malinda Hamby, Newton Hamby, Malinda Hamby, Henry Hamby
The story of Sarah Brasher began in 1793 in Greenville County, South Carolina, United States of America. In 1860, Sarah Brasher resided in West Half of County, Dycusburg, Crittenden, Kentuc. In 1870, Sarah Brasher resided in Hamby, Hopkinsville, Christian, Kentucky, USA. Sarah Brasher married James Hamby, Jeremiah Hamby, and had children including Campaspa Lena Hamby, Henry Isabell Hamby, Malinda E Hamby, Malinda G Hamby, Maryann Hamby, Newton I Hamby, Prueesia A Hamby. Sarah Brasher passed away in 1870 in Kentucky, USA.
